Commitment Depth Telescoping
Abstract
Commitment depth is the finite telescoping loss of compatible future-plan capacity.
Proposition 1.1 (Commitment depth telescopes along a finite history).

Commentary.
The source object is a finite sequence of compatible future-plan spaces. At each step, commitment depth is constructed as the decrease in its base-two log-cardinality.
The finite sum cancels every intermediate plan-space capacity, leaving only the initial capacity minus the terminal capacity. The result also holds for an empty plan space under Lean’s total real logarithm.
